Design and Aesthetics

The 1973 MGB GT Overdrive featured a stunning coupe body design that exuded elegance and charm. The iconic exterior, designed by Pininfarina, showcased smooth curves and sharp lines that made it stand out in the crowded sports car market. The signature chrome-plated bumpers, wire-spoke wheels, and distinctive GT badging added to its overall appeal.

The interior of the MGB GT Overdrive was equally impressive. Comfortable leather seats, a wood-trimmed dashboard, and a three-spoke steering wheel provided a touch of sophistication. Though the cabin space was relatively compact, it offered ample legroom and headroom, making it a practical and comfortable choice for everyday use.

Performance and Engineering

Under the hood, the 1973 MGB GT Overdrive was powered by a 1.8-liter, four-cylinder engine, mated to a four-speed manual transmission with an optional overdrive. This overdrive feature was one of the defining elements of the car, providing an extra gear ratio for more relaxed highway cruising and improved fuel efficiency. The engine produced around 95 horsepower, allowing the MGB GT Overdrive to reach a top speed of approximately 108 mph (173 km/h) and accelerate from 0 to 100 km/h in just over 12 seconds.

The MGB GT Overdrive featured a front-engine, rear-wheel-drive layout, which, combined with its well-tuned suspension and balanced weight distribution, ensured a thrilling driving experience. While not as fast as some of its contemporaries, the MGB GT Overdrive made up for it with its nimble handling and overall driving pleasure.

Legacy and Impact

Upon its release, the MGB GT Overdrive was met with immense acclaim, garnering praise for its style, performance, and affordability. Its success was not limited to the United Kingdom; it quickly gained popularity in international markets, particularly in the United States.

Beyond its commercial success, the MGB GT Overdrive became a cultural icon. It starred in numerous movies and television shows, solidifying its place in automotive history. Even today, classic car enthusiasts and collectors seek out the MGB GT Overdrive for its timeless appeal and collectible value.

The MGB GT Overdrive also played a crucial role in British automotive history. It was one of the last true British sports cars to be manufactured before the industry underwent significant changes. Stricter safety and emission regulations in the mid-1970s led to the decline of many classic sports car models, marking the end of an era in British motoring.
